Key Points
Synthesis of imidazopyridines is enhanced using a Cu(II)-functionalized catalyst, significantly increasing yield.
The catalyst utilizes magnetic Fe₃O₄@SiO₂, allowing for easy separation and reuse in multiple cycles.
Deep eutectic solvents serve as an effective medium for the catalytic process, promoting environmentally friendly reactions.
This approach underscores potential improvements in catalytic efficiency and sustainability in organic synthesis.
